    ISAF-NATO medal Parade to Spanish Forces

    QALA I NAW, AFGHANISTAN

    05.05.2012

    Courtesy Story

    ISAF Regional Command West

    By Lt. Col. Javier Nicolás García-Clavo y Díaz
    Regional Command-West Public Affairs

    QALA I NAW, Afghanistan - Today, at 9 a.m. the Spanish Forces in Afghanistan, carried out a military parade for the imposition of the ISAF NATO medal "Non Article 5" to the military people present in the base "Ruy Gonzalez de Clavijo," headquarters of the Spanish Provincial Reconstruction Team in the Afghan province of Badghis.

    The ceremony was chaired by the Chief of Spanish forces in Qala i Naw, Col. Demetrio Muñoz Garcia.

    The military parade began with the hoisting of the Spanish flag while the play of the national hymn and the reciting of the "Spanish Legion spirits." Then it took place the reading of the medal formula and the imposition of the medals. The colonel delivered an emotional speech, mentioning the well done work and encouraged all present there to continue this line of fine effort to the end.

    While the sound of the Spanish Legion hymn "The Groom of The Death," it was discovered a plaque in memory of the 1st Sgt. Joaquin Moya Espejo, dead in combat last November, 2011. The military ceremony ended with a parade of all participating units.
